Messy art

Messy art photo by Thad Smith via Flickr

Stop by the library today (Wednesday, December 9, 2015) at 3:30pm for the inaugural “Beautiful Mess” kids’ art day.

What are we making? Whatever you want — and it’s going to be beautiful. And messy. This afterschool art program allows kids to focus more on the process than the product, whether we’re using clay, watercolors, pencils or odds and ends. We might not know where this art project is going, but we’ll have lots of fun getting there.
